Definition : Legal person

A body granted juridical personality independent and autonomous from its members and which possesses rights and obligations (for example, a company, a syndicate of co-owners). Without limitation, the latter has a patrimony and the capacity to take legal action or enter into contracts. It has a name which is given to it at the time of its constitution and exercises its rights and executes its obligations under this name. Legal persons are to be distinguished from natural persons.
